Acrokeratoelastoidosis of Oswaldo Costa, or inverse papular acrokeratosis, is a rare genodermatosis first described in 1952 by Oswaldo Costa, a Brazilian dermatologist. It is characterized by flesh-colored papules on the lateral aspects of the palms and soles and dorsum of hands. The histological features are hyperkeratosis, hyalinized and homogenous collagen, and a decrease in and fragmentation of the elastic fibers (elastorrhexis). In the absence of elastic fiber fragmentation, a similar clinical presentation is diagnosed as focal acral hyperkeratosis. Many cases of inverse papular acrokeratosis of Oswaldo Costa may have been considered focal acral hyperkeratosis since it can be difficult to find the elastorrhexis. The authors report a case of a 51-year-old woman with inverse papular acrokeratosis of Oswaldo Costa with poor response to topical treatments.
In addition to original research, Far-Manguinhos, the Pharmaceutical Division of the Brazilian Ministry of Health's Oswaldo Cruz Foundation (FIOCRUZ), devotes major attention to the finalising of products for use in public health campaigns or, under contract, for private industrial development. Emphasis is on standardisation, adequate supply, safety in use and efficacy. Among the products discussed in this summary of some of its activities in the chemical and pharmaceutical fields are medicinal plants Bidens pilosa, Cymbopogon citratus, Copaifera species, Mentha crispa, Phyllanthus tenellus Roxb. and other Phyllanthus species, insecticidal plants, Lonchocarpus urucu and Quassia amara, and the insect antifeedant plants Carapa guianensis and Pterodon emarginatus.
The Oswaldo Cruz Institute, founded on May25th, 1900 under the name “Instituto SoroterapicoFederal” (Federal Serotherapic Institute), has al-ways played an important role in the Brazilian soci-ety. Its foundation aimed at controlling the bubonicplague, the yellow fever and the smallpox, whichraged all over the city of Rio de Janeiro at that time.Such diseases were decimating the population, hin-dering the economic and social development of thecountry as the foreign ships, the only internationalmeans of transport then, were not allowed to anchorin our ports due to their unsanitary conditions.The two first papers – “Contribution to the studyon culicidae in Rio de Janeiro” and “The anti-plague vaccination” , in Brazil-Medico , volume 15,numbers 43 and 45 respectively – published in1901 by Oswaldo Cruz in this Institute, soon afterits creation, illustrate the institution’s vocation tobiomedical research and public health.The discoveries that took place in this Instituteas well as its countless research works helped Bra-zil to be awarded with the first prize (beating 123competing countries) at the International HygieneExposition in Berlin in 1907. This fact promptedthe National Congress to pay homage to OswaldoCruz, naming the Institute after him, by officialdecree number 1802, of December 12th 1907.The “Temple for Science”, symbolized by theMoorish Castle (Fig. 1), was ordered by OswaldoCruz as of 1904. It was built on the top of a hill onthe Manguinhos Farm in Rio de Janeiro in order toexhibit to the world the new status of the Brazilianpublic health. Like the Alhambra Palace on theSabika hills overlooks the city of Granada in Spain,our castle overlooked the sea. As a matter of fact,there are many similarities between the two pal-aces. The Moorish style – the Spanish-muslim ar-chitecture from the period between the 9th and12th centuries –, the mosaic and pottery featuresand the sculptured brick and wood work make usthink that the castle must have been inspired byThe Alhambra palace. However, there is no evi-dence of Cruz’s thoughts at that time.Our “Temple for Science” today comprises fif-teen departments and sixty research laboratories;twelve centers of reference and four institutionalcollections, with more than 350 researchers (mostof whom hold a PhD); it also includes a TeachingDepartment with over 600 students in post-gradu-ation courses (Master’s, Doctorate, intensive andadvanced training) as well as scientific initiationand vocation. We also publish the most modernand important scientific publication about biomedi-cal research in Latin America – the Memorias doInstituto Oswaldo Cruz – founded in 1909. TheManguinhos Application Course, also founded in1909 may be considered as the first official post-graduation course in Brazil.Besides being the pride of Brazilian Science,the Oswaldo Cruz Institute is one of the most pro-ductive research institutions in this country. It sup-ports several programs from other institutes in-side the Oswaldo Cruz Foundation such as the“Biomanguinhos Institute”, which produces vac-cines against yellow fever and other important dis-eases affecting public health; the “FarmanguinhosInstitute”, responsible for the production of basicmedicines for the Ministry of Health; the “QualityControl Institute”; the “Fernandes Figueira Insti-tute”, as well as works in cooperation with somenational and foreign universities.The twelve reference centers of the OswaldoCruz Institute grant an important support to the Na-tional Health Foundation and the Public HealthLaboratories from all Brazilian states. Such centersare responsible for the diagnosis of yellow fever,respiratory virus-infections, measles, viral hepati-tis, infectious diarrhea (cause of the great infantmortality), leprosy, vectors of malaria, the Chagasdisease, schistosomiasis and leishmaniasis.The Oswaldo Cruz Institute is regarded as agenuine institution of national integration as it de-velops researches throughout the interior of thecountry, from the State of Amazonas to the Stateof Rio Grande do Sul, specially in the northeast-ern, middle-western and the Amazon regions.
